 Run the Tomeo prototype in Qt Creator, explore its (limited and buggy) functionality.

 Explore the code. In particular note the following classes, and read any Qt 
documentation you need to:

 tomeo.cpp: contains the main method and creates a list of video files that have 
thumbnails.

 the_button.cpp: a subclass of QPushButton which shows the icon, and has a 
signal (jumpTo) that is fired when someone clicks it.

 the_player.cpp: a subclass of QMediaPlayer which controls the playback of the 
video in the QVideoWidget class.

Weekly Process

You will complete at least 3 development iteration cycles of your app before the due date 
above. For this coursework, one iteration consists of:
i. prototyping an improvement
ii. implementing the prototype
iii. evaluating the prototype
There is no requirement to continue with the Tomeo starter code but you are welcome to 
do so if it simplifies the process

We are developing a prototype, so it is acceptable for certain parts to be partially 
developed. You should develop all necessary components of the system to evaluate the 
central concept of your weekly iteration. However, some peripheral functionality may be 
partial. 
For example:
A "load" button may just show a dialog saying "you selected a video" before 
showing the loaded video, rather than creating a full file chooser.
A range of effects and tools can be ‘just’ buttons / menus
Video thumbnail images may be loaded from disk rather than computed or from 
network storage (the given prototype does this).
You could consider running different iterations in parallel (at the same time) to spread the 
work between group-members, as long as iterations are branched then merged into a 
single code base if successful. For example:
different people could perform parallel cycles to prototype, evaluate, and code the 
layout of the home screen - then one is picked to be taken forward.
different components could be built by different pairs of people – a dialogue box 
could be a parallel cycle to the main screen visual design.
